    Why is there no Quidditch in Hogwarts Legacy

    In the new video game of the universe of Harry Potter You can, of course, cast the best-known spells from the franchise’s books and movies, from Lumos and other harmless charms to the three Unforgivable Curses: Crucio, Imperio, and the deadly Avada Kedabra. You can also pet the cats that walk through the centuries-old halls of Hogwarts or take a bath in the lake next to the school, with mermaids and mermen. And, obviously, there will be no shortage of flying broom rides. But a fundamental ingredient of school life at Dumbledore’s institution, Quidditch is totally missing. And the excuse that the video game gives to leave the king of sports out of the wizarding world is, honestly, pretty poor.

    After some leaks of the development on social networks, the players had their hopes up, but the truth is that there is no sign of Quidditch in Hogwarts Legacy. The magical sport, a kind of rugby with players riding on flying brooms and four different balls with a life of their own, has been left out of the playable elements of the Warner Bros. Games title for a most absurd reason: within the game, the Hogwarts headmaster at the time the plot unfolds, Phineas Nigellus Black, explains to the students at the school that Quidditch is banned for the entire course due to an “unfortunate injury” suffered by a player in the final last spring.

    Even so, Hogwarts Legacy it is full of flying brooms with which you can even participate in races; Also, the Quidditch field It does exist within the game map. Therefore, it is not unreasonable to think that, if the title is as successful as expected, this modality can be included as extra downloadable content or DLC in the future.
